Metric LT hose fittings are designed for use with low-pressure hydraulic applications. These fittings are essential in connecting hoses and pipes securely, ensuring fluid transfer without leaks. Knowing their specifications, such as sizes, materials, and pressure ratings, is vital for making an informed decision.
Before diving into the selection process, it's crucial to assess the requirements of your application. Consider factors such as the type of fluid being transported, operating pressure, and temperature conditions. This evaluation will help you determine the compatible fittings that will withstand the demands of your system.
Size matters when selecting metric LT hose fittings. The diameter of the hose and the corresponding fitting should be adequately matched to ensure efficient flow and minimize pressure loss. Additionally, incorrect sizing can lead to potential leaks and failure of the connection.
Different materials offer varying levels of resistance to corrosion, temperature fluctuations, and chemical exposure. Common materials for metric LT hose fittings include brass, stainless steel, and plastic. Evaluate the environmental conditions the fittings will be exposed to and choose a material that guarantees longevity and performance.
Each fitting is designed to operate within specific pressure limits. Consult the manufacturer’s specifications to ensure the fittings can handle the operating pressure of your system. Using a fitting with an inadequate pressure rating may lead to catastrophic failures, posing safety risks and incurring unnecessary costs.

Metric LT fittings come in various connection types, such as threaded, push-on, and crimped. The choice of connection impacts installation processes and maintenance. Evaluate the ease of installation and whether the fitting type is suitable for your specific use case and existing setup.
Familiarizing yourself with general industry standards is essential when selecting fittings. Standards ensure compatibility and safety across different manufacturers and systems. When choosing metric LT hose fittings, check if they comply with international standards to guarantee quality and reliability.
